2.3 IA188XL Pin/Signal Descriptions
Descriptions of the pin and signal functions for the IA188XL microcontroller are provided in
Table 8.
Several of the IA188XL pins have different functions depending on the operating mode of the
device. Each of the different signals supported by a pin is listed and defined in Table 8, indexed
alphabetically in the first column of the table. Additionally, the name of the pin associated with
the signal as well as the pin numbers for the PLCC, QFP, and LQFP packages are provided in the
“Pin” column.

Description
Latched address bit a1. Output.
Latched address bit a2. Output.
address bits 16–19. Output.
These pins provide the four most-significant
bits of the Address Bus during T1 only. During
T2, T3, TW and T4 they provide bus status.
address/data bits 0 - 15. Input/Output.
These pins provide the multiplexed Address
Bus and Data Bus. During the address
portion of the IA188XL bus cycle, address bits
0 through 15 are presented on the bus and
can be latched using the ale signal (see next
table entry). During the data portion of the
IA188XL bus cycle, data are present on these
lines.
valid address information is provided for the
entire bus cycle
